Best Season to Trek Pikey Peak:

Every season offers unique experiences to travelers, leaving them in awe and inspiration. Ideally, spring, autumn and winter are considered the best seasons to trek for Pikey due to clear visibility, stable weather, moderated temperature and easy access to the paths.

Spring (March- May): Trek offers a pleasant atmosphere, rhododendron blooms in the forests with pink, red and white colors, with beautiful and clear Himalayan views

Autumn season (September- November): Trek offers blue skies with unobstructed Himalayan views. The eight highest peaks in Nepal above 8000m can be seen only from Pikey Peak Hill, they are Everest (8848.86 m), Kanchenjunga (8586 m), Lhotse (8516 m), Makalu (8,485 m), Cho Oyu, Dhaulagiri, Manaslu and Annapurna I.

Winter season (December- February): Trek offers clear views but is colder with snowfall paths; the trail is quieter than usual.

Summer/Rainy season (June- August): Summer season Trek offers wildflowers in the meadows and pastureland of Pikey Peak. Leeches, monsoon and cloud cover distract people from the adventure of monsoon treks.

Necessary Permits for Lower EBC Trek

As per the rules and regulations of Nepal, for the Pikey Peak or lower EBC trek, two main permits are required for the Pikey Peak trek in Nepal.

Gaurishankhar Conservation Area Permit

TIMS-Card (Trekkers Information Management Systems)

Pikey Peak Difficulty level:

Pikey Peak is an easier-level scenic trek suitable for beginners in the foothills of Mt. Everest. The trekking path passes through the lower region of Everest, Solukhumbu. The Pikey Peak trek involves 5/6 hours of daily walking into the wilderness. The highest point of the trek is 4065 m, so there is a chance of getting altitude sickness. You may encounter wildlife like leopards, pandas, and bears. A solo trek can be dangerous. 

Pikey Peak Accommodation

Accommodation on ikey Peak trails is at cozy teahouses and local lodges are operated by local Sherpa families in the area. The room facilities are basic twin rooms including bed, mattresses and blankets. It is highly recommended to bring a sleeping bag for warmth.

  • Bathroom: Bathrooms and toilets are within shared space but close by your room. Hot and cold shower is available for an extra charge.
  • Dining:Communal dinner space with wood-fired stoves can be seen in dining areas. Nepali thali, Sherpa stew, Tibetan breads and momos and some continental cuisines are available at the trekking trails.
  • Electricity: Room is ignited through solar power. Electricity is available for basic charging and lightning through solar power. Charging electronics may cost extra depending on the region.
  • Wifi: Wifi in Pikey Peak is rare and unavailable. You have to use a local SIM, but they also have poor network coverage due to the terrain.

Pikey Peak Trek Itinerary Overview

Global Eco trails team crafted 7 days itinerary for Pikey Peak Trek. It is a short but spectacular lower Everest trek offering breathtaking Himalayan views from Kanchenjunga to Annapurna. This is the only one place that offer all above 8000 m mountain lies in Nepal. Our 7 days itinerary is customizable as per customer needs. The trek starts from Dhap Bazar and ends at Phaplu.

Day 01: Kathmandu to Dhap by Jeep [2,850 m / 230 km / 7 hrs]

Day 02: Dhap Trek to Jhapre [2,815 m / 15 km / 6hours]

Day 03: Jhapre Trek to Pikey Peak Base Camp [3,645m / 13.7 km/ 6 hours]

Day 04: Morning hike to Pikey Peak [4,065 m / 3 hrs.], then descend to Jasmane [5 km/ 3 hours]

Day 05: Jasmane Trek to Junbesi, 11 km/ 5 hrs. Enjoy the beautiful Sherpa Village and overnight at Junbensi.

Day 06: Junbesi Trek to Phaplu [2380 m/ 13 km/ 5 hours]

Day 07: Phaplu to Kathmandu by a public Jeep [270 km/10 hours] Optional 30 minutes flight to Kathmandu.

Add-ons & Options

  • Porter Services: Our package excludes the porter. A porter service is available for a small additional fee. If you're new to mountain trekking, hiring a porter is highly recommended to ensure a more comfortable journey. The cost of a porter is USD 170, which includes their meals, accommodation, trekking gear, insurance. Porter carry up to 20 kg of luggage, which can be shared between two trekkers.
  • Private Jeep Services: Our package includes all local transportation as outlined in the itinerary. However, if you prefer a private Jeep service to and from Dhap, the cost is USD 205 each way.
  • Phaplu to Kathmandu Flight Ticket: While our package includes public ground transportation, flights between Kathmandu and Phaplu are available three times a week. The cost for a one-way flight is USD 174
